Panasonic DMREX768EBK Black (DVD Recorder - With MR playback, HDMI, Freeview and 160Gb hard drive)

Click here for a larger picture

Packed full with the latest technology, the DMREX768 is Panasonic's best value, most highly equipped DVD/HDD recorder to date.

At the heart of the new Panasonic DVDR/HDD is a new picture processor with Adaptive Noise Reduction. Designed specifically to work with Freeview, digital TV, ANR detects and removes block noise that can occur with digital broadcasts. The result is a much more realistic picture with both playback and recordings. In addition to this, the DMREX768 also features Diagonal Processing to bring definition to edges and Deep Colour compatibility for richer images with greater depth. As if this battery of picture enhancements wasn't enough, Panasonic have fitted the DMREX768 with the latest v1.3 HDMI socket that's capable of 1080P definition. Combined with the built-in upscaler, it means that the Panasonic can upscale any DVD to full 1080p resolution.

As with previous Panasonic DVDRs, at the heart of this wonderfully flexible recorder is a Super Multi Format system that can utilise pretty much any blank disc you'd care to throw at it. DVD+R/+RW, DVD-R/-RW and even DVD-RAM discs can all be used for recording. Yet, the hassle free recording doesn't end there. Thanks to a built-in 160GB hard drive, the DMREX768 is capable of recording up to 284 hours of programs without the need for a single blank disc!

Add in Viera link for easy connection to a Panasonic TV, 1-sec Quick Start and Direct TV record, and it's easy to see why Panasonic DVDR/HDD recorders have been so popular. For the best in DVDR/HDD look no further!

FEATURES

Print Features

Record With +r Discs?Does it record with DVD+R discs?  Yes
Record With -R Discs?Does it record with DVD-R discs?  Yes
Record With -Rw Discs?Does it record with DVD-RW discs?  Yes
Record With +rw Discs?Does it record with DVD+RW discs?  Yes
Record With Ram Discs?Does it record with DVD-RAM discs?  Yes
Hard Disc?Does it feature an HDD? This is a built-in disc, like a home PC, which can hold hours of programmes  Yes
Hard Disc Size?The higher the figure the greater the amount of programmes that can be held on disc 160GB
Hdmi Output?Does it feature an HDMI output? The highest quality of digital output to TV or AV amp.  Yes
Optical Output?Does it feature a digital optical output for connection to AV amp?  Yes
Coaxial Output?Does it feature a coaxial digital output for connection to AV amp?  No
Progressive Scan?Does it feature Progressive scan? Gives a more stable and natural picture  Yes
Component Output?Does it feature a component output? Highest quality analogue output which also carries Progressive Scan signals  Yes
Dv (Digital) Input?Does it feature a DV input? A digital input that is typically found on digital camcorders - allows for easy transfer to DVD recorder  No
No. Of Scart Sockets?Number of SCART sockets included? 2 Scart sockets allows for more flexible recording. 2
Remote Control?Is an Infra-red remote control included?  Yes
Divx Compatible?Will it play DivX/MPEG 4 discs? This is a compressed video format often used for files exchanged on the web. Some recorders will play this format back  No
Upscaling?Does it feature upscaling? Upscaling improves the picture quality of standard DVD discs. 1080p is superior to 1080i. 1080P
Freeview?Does the built-in tuner feature Freeview? Freeview digital tuner built-in for recording of digital TV channels.  Yes
DimensionsDimensions of unit (W x D x H) mm. 430 x 326 x 59
